Warren Road Greenspace team
-
As Chelsfield and the Warren Road area becomes increasingly popular, it is more important than ever to keep the area clean and green so that we can all continue to enjoy the benefits of our surroundings.
Since 2011 local residents have been litter picking and working with Bromley Council and its contractor, idverde to maintain the pathways, green areas and woodlands around Warren Road. A huge amount of litter, fly-tipping and graffiti have been removed. This local group has been formed to further improve the area with the support of Bromley Council and also by possible external grant funding.
We meet at the green area of Warren Road, opposite the top end of Cloonmore Avenue, at 10am to collect equipment and receive a safety briefing. Equipment, bags, gloves, litter grabbers and hiviz jackets are provided. We will then work individually (or in family groups). At the end of the litter pick (around 11.15am), filled rubbish bags should be left at the junction of Warren Road/Meadway for collection by IDverde. We then visit the Café in Windsor Drive after the event for tea, coffee and a chat. (cafe closed at present expected to reopen soon)
